Output b321c28198923ceca100b7a8024092569f058c9c2c2ce376c3158564308e839d:7

value
18813755734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f7ecf6540937e18cb358bf771cea4673d57f20 OP_EQUAL
address
3P28NR3CgZUz1JXjG9fBy5Fry6955eVZeT
transaction
b321c28198923ceca100b7a8024092569f058c9c2c2ce376c3158564308e839d
spent
true